How do I know if Google Tag Manager is working?
- Check the source code of the website by right-clicking on any of the web pages and selecting ‘View page source’ then find the GTM container code, if it is present that means Google Tag Manager is working.
- Use Google Tag manager’s preview and debug mode.
How do I test Google Tag Manager locally?
There’s no need to do anything different in local development to test it. Just enable the debug/preview mode in the GTM Panel, then in the same browser you can access your website and there will be a console window at the bottom of the page, there you can see important info about the tags.

How do I troubleshoot Google Tag Manager?
How to Troubleshoot Broken Tags
- Step 1: Fire up GTM Preview Mode.
- Step 2: Visit Your Website Once Preview Mode Is Enabled.
- Step 3: Find Which Tag(s) is Not Firing and Click On It.
- Step 4: Identify the Reason Why Your Tag(s) Is Not Firing.
How do I see Google Tag Manager results in Google Analytics?
If you have implemented Google Analytics 4 with Google Tag Manager, you can check if your data is being sent to GA4. First, enable the Preview mode in GTM, then go to GA4 > DebugView and check if you see some data. You can learn more about the DebugView here.

How do I use Google Analytics Debugger?
Checking your tracking code for errors
- Visit the Google Chrome store for Google Analytics Debugger.
- Click the Available on Chrome button on the top right.
- Next, Click the GA Debugging icon at the top right to turn the Google Analytics Debugger On.
- Visit the your site to view the Google Analytics process.
Why is my GTM preview not working?
Try exiting the preview mode and entering it once again. Close the preview mode’s tab, close the website tab. Then click the Preview button once again in the GTM interface and complete all the steps to enable it. This worked for me multiples times.
